Perhaps the one person on the quest that Klein Maddox didn't expect to be comforting, was Piper McLean. And she felt sound in that expectation, for the two girls had been so far from the lines of friendliness the entire quest that it was as if they were on different maps.
Yet there she was, standing on the edge of the runway where they were sending Tristan McLean off, with the daughter of Aphrodite sobbing into the front of her shirt. She hadn't volunteered for the position, and when the girl had turned around Klein had expected her to go right to Jason.
To everyone's surprise, Piper all but collapsed onto Klein.
"Oh, sweet Jesus." Klein nearly yelped, barely keeping the McLean girl from dropping right to the ground. She looked to the two other demigods with a look of complete and utter 'what the fuck?'.
What did I do to deserve this?
Jason held his hands up as if to say 'I got nothing'. Leo pulled a Kleenex out of his tool belt to keep at the ready and offered the Maddox girl a thumbs up.
After deciding she was most likely going to kill the two boys, Klein awkwardly patted the other girls back as she continued to cry, offering an almost laughable "There, there."
At that, the two boys were looking at her and wondering what the hell the girl was doing. In Klein's defense, she really had no idea. The Maddox girl, no matter how sweet and nice she had been before the war, had never exactly been the comforting type. She was the one who cheered someone up, who restored the smiles and the laughs, but she was scarcely the one who was there to stop the tears.
Besides, she hadn't exactly been kidding when she told Piper she wanted to do a hell of a lot more than just yell at her when the McLean girl revealed that she had been lying to everyone the entire journey. And considering the way her and Piper had gone back and forth (especially since the sewers post-Cyclops attack), it was almost laughable that Klein was the one of the group that was in the current consoling position.
Piper choked back a breath, "I'm terrible."
Ah, nuts.
Fighting every urge she had to agree (which was many), Klein pulled back and put a hand on either of Piper's shoulders. "You're not terrible."
"You definitely think I'm terrible."
"Okay... well, maybe a little bit." Klein didn't need to turn around to see the faces the other two were making. "But not for this. You saved your dad."
"But did you see him? He was... he looked-"
"Alive. Safe. A little distraught, but I think that's a given. He's gonna be okay."
"I don't know... I just can't believe-"
"Just listen, okay? What happened on that mountain was totally insane, and we went in without a plan or any idea of what the hell we were gonna do. You could have just turned us over to Enceladus, grabbed your dad, and dipped, but you didn't. And you still managed to save your dad. That's pretty badass, yeah?"
Whatever solace Klein's words gave were nothing compared to Piper's next though. "Oh gods, we sent him off with Coach Hedge."
"Your dad's in good hands, Piper." Jason spoke up from behind the duo, the blonde almost letting out a sigh of relief because oh thank gods, tag you're it. "And Klein's right. You saved him."
The daughter of Aphrodite sniffled, nodded, and then looked like she wanted to drop dead because it just seemed to register who she had sobbed to.
"Oh gods." She groaned, a pained look overtaking her face as she looked at the Maddox girl. "I'm... sorry."
